Medals and sausages at Bristol softball event
The Bristol Softball Association held the inaugral Charity Shield and End of Season softball BBQ on Wednesday, September 9, 2009 at the Abbotts Leigh Cricket Club.
Under cobalt blue skies an audience of approximately 170 people watched as Division 1 Champions, LSDs, played the All Stars team, which was made up of the seasons MVPs from each division and managed by Mark Fenton.
LSDs got an early lead with some outstanding batting, and by closing the All Stars down in the first innings.
However, the All Stars held their nerve and chipped back at LSDs for the next couple of innings and both teams were even at the 4th.
LSDs were out-batted by the All Stars, who grew in confidence and strength and went on to win the game.
After the game and the BBQ that was well received by all, everyone squeezed into the cricket club pavillion for the prize-giving ceremony, where prizes were awarded for all MVPs, winners and runners-up of all Divisions.
Chris Moon, Chairman of the BSA concluded the prizegiving by awarding his Chairman's Award for Outstanding Contribution to the BSA to two individuals this year. Jo Stretton, Treasurer and Saghi Zarbafi, Tournaments and Communications Officer.
The evening raised £242.80 for The Wallace and Gromit Grand Appeal - the chosen charity of LSDs as winners of Division 1.
